Windows Updates: Securing Your Windows OS with the Latest Updates
Update Hub, also referred to as the Windows Update Hub is a built-in management system for handling software updates in Windows. Shipped by default with Windows 10 and Windows 11 operating systems. It plays an important role in preventing security breaches by installing updates. Improving system performance by delivering essential updates and enhancements.
Virtual Desktop Support: Simplifying Multitasking with Multiple Virtual Desktops
Virtual Desktop Support is part of the Windows 10 and Windows 11 operating systems. It helps you keep your workspace organized by expanding it with multiple desktops. Virtual Desktop Support offers features for easy creation and removal of virtual desktops. It is available in all editions of Windows 10 and Windows 11, providing broad access.
